Angularでルーティングを使用したモジュールの生成方法


まず、新しいモジュールを作成するためにAngular CLIを使用します。以下のコマンドを使用して、新しいモジュールとそのルーティングファイルを作成します。

ng generate module my-module --routing

このコマンドは、"my-module"という名前の新しいモジュールを生成し、ルーティングファイルも同時に作成します。

次に、作成されたモジュールのルーティングファイル(my-module-routing.module.ts)を開きます。このファイルでは、異なるパスに基づいて表示されるコンポーネントを指定します。

ルーティングファイルの例を以下に示します。

import { NgModule } from '@angular/core';
import { Routes, RouterModule } from '@angular/router';
import { HomeComponent } from './home.component';
import { AboutComponent } from './about.component';
const routes: Routes = [
  { path: '', component: HomeComponent },
  { path: 'about', component: AboutComponent }
];
@NgModule({
  imports: [RouterModule.forChild(routes)],
  exports: [RouterModule]
})
export class MyModuleRoutingModule { }

この例では、ルートパス('')にはHomeComponentが表示され、'/about'パスにはAboutComponentが表示されます。

最後に、モジュールを他のコンポーネントで使用するために、必要な手順を行います。これには、モジュールをインポートすることや、ルーティングを設定することなどが含まれます。

以上がAngularでルーティングを使用してモジュールを生成する方法の基本的な概要です。詳細なコードや設定は、特定の要件や目的に応じて変更することができます。

この記事では、Angularでルーティングを使用したモジュールの生成方法を解説しました。さまざまなパスに基づいて異なるコンポーネントを表示するためのモジュールの設定方法について説明しました。